CSX to pay convertible put in cash
New York, Oct. 2 - CSX Corp. said it will pay the upcoming put on its zero-coupon convertible debentures due 2021 in cash.
The securities are putable on Oct. 30 at their accreted value of $835.65 per $1,000 principal amount at maturity.
The Jacksonville, Fla. railroad had the option to pay the put in cash, stock or a combination.
CSX issued $490 million principal amount at maturity of the convertibles in October 2001.
